编译优化实战:赋能资讯处理高效化
|
图形AI提供,仅供参考 在信息爆炸的时代,资讯处理的效率直接决定了决策的速度与质量。面对海量数据,传统的处理方式往往显得力不从心。编译优化技术作为底层支撑,正悄然改变这一局面。它不仅提升程序运行速度,更在数据吞吐、内存使用和响应延迟方面带来显著改善。编译优化的核心在于“理解”代码的运行意图。现代编译器通过静态分析,识别出冗余计算、重复表达式和低效内存访问模式。例如,将常量表达式提前计算,避免运行时反复求值;或通过循环展开减少分支判断开销。这些看似微小的调整,在高频处理场景下能带来数倍性能提升。 在资讯处理中,文本解析、关键词提取与结构化转换是常见任务。借助编译优化,这类操作可被重构为更高效的指令序列。例如,将字符串匹配算法转化为位运算或查表机制,大幅降低时间复杂度。同时,编译器还能自动进行函数内联与死代码消除,让程序体积更小、执行更快。 值得一提的是,现代编译器支持针对特定硬件的优化。通过启用SIMD指令集或利用CPU缓存特性,资讯处理流程可实现并行化加速。这使得单次处理千条新闻摘要,从秒级缩短至毫秒级,极大提升了实时性。 编译优化还增强了系统的可维护性。清晰的中间表示与优化路径,使开发者更容易定位性能瓶颈。结合性能分析工具,可以精准识别热点代码,实现针对性优化,形成“写得快、跑得快”的良性循环。 当编译优化融入资讯处理流程,不仅是技术层面的跃升,更是思维模式的进化。它让我们不再被动应对数据洪流,而是主动驾驭效率杠杆,让每一条信息都能快速转化为有价值的洞察。在智能化时代,这正是高效决策的基石。 (编辑:航空爱好网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

